Sister M. Voegerl's Obituary
Sister Mary Maura Voegerl, died peacefully at Franciscan Courts on Thursday afternoon, March 29, 2012 in Oshkosh, WI. She was 93 years old. She was born on October 13, 1918 to parents, Joseph and Maria (Schindbeck) Voegerl in Ittelhofen, Germany. At birth she was given the name Johanna Voegerl. She was one of seven children. She entered the religious community of the Sisters of the Sorrowful Mother on September 19, 1946 in Abenberg, Germany. On March 19, 1947 she became a candidate. On March 19, 1949 she professed her first vows; professed final vows on August 12, 1954. She celebrated her Silver Jubilee on August 19, 1974; Golden Jubilee on January 1, 1999 and her 60th Jubilee on September 20, 2009. She served in the Dietary Department and also did Seamstress work at the St. Joseph Hospital in Marshfield, Wisconsin. She later worked at the Generalate House in Rome, Italy sewing and helping Pilgrim guests. She returned to the US coming to Denville, New Jersey.
